
As part of the Peruvian Children's Day, which is commemorated this second Sunday in April, l National Registry of Identification and Civil Status (Reniec) published on its social networks a list with the names of Peruvian girls and boys related to characters from cartoons, films and favorite series by the youngest members of the house. Among them, there are names such as Vegeta (from Dragon Ball Z), Snow White, Barbie and Sonic.
This is the list of names of Peruvian girls and boys taken from characters from children's fiction:
- Ariel: the name of the character of the Little Mermaid is worn by 5199 people.
- Candy: the name of the main character of the animated series of the same name is worn by 855 people.
- Alvin: the name of the character from the movie Alvin and the Chipmunks is worn by 313 people.
- Moana: the name of the character from the movie Moana: A Sea of Adventures is carried by 222 people.
- Otto: The character's name from several animated series such as The Simpsons and Rocket Power is worn by 199 people.
- Zendaya: the name of the Marvel actress is worn by 165 people.
- Aladdin: the name of the main character of the animated series of the same name is worn by 162 people.
- Destiny: the name of the video game character is worn by 53 people.
- Mary Jane: the name of the character of Spider-Man is worn by 49 people.
- Snow White: the name of the character from the classic film of the same name is carried by 43 people.
- Barbie: the name of the character of one of the most favorite toys by many girls is worn by 23 people.
- Hulk: The name of the green character is carried by 17 people.
- Rapunzel: the name of the long-haired character is worn by 17 people.
- Thor: The name of the Marvel character is carried by 16 people.
- Frodo: The name of the character of The Lord of the Rings is worn by 6 people.
- Frozen: the name of the character from the movie of the same name is carried by 5 people.
- Red: the name of the Pokémon character is carried by 5 people.
- Minnie: 4 people are named after the couple of Mickey Mouse.
- Vegeta: the name of the prince of the sayayins (from Dragon Ball Z) is carried by 4 people.
- Sonic: that's what 4 people are called.
- Cinderella: 3 people are named after the classic character of the story.
PERUVIAN CHILDREN'S DAY
On the other hand, the Presidency of the Republic published a message on the occasion of Peruvian Children's Day, which is commemorated this Sunday. Through his Twitter account, he stressed that, with the face-to-face return to school classes, which took place this year, the integral development of Peruvian children is strengthened.
“The defense and promotion of their rights will make it possible to achieve the well-being of children and to grow up in a truly egalitarian and just society,” they said.
It should be recalled that, according to Law No. 27666, passed in 2002, the Day of the Peruvian Child is celebrated every second Sunday in April.
